Capt. Dimitrios I. Flokas
Founder & CEO / Managing Director · London, UK

As Founder & CEO of NaviTrade Energy Ltd., Capt. Dimitrios I. Flokas leads a London-based boutique brokerage and trading office focused on the structured sourcing, negotiation and facilitation of refined petroleum products, crude oil grades, LPG/LNG and marine fuels across Europe, the Middle East, Africa and Central Asia.

His path into energy trading was not conventional. While most enter the sector through finance, sales or corporate trading desks, Capt. Dimitris came from the sea — from the bridge, the deck, the cargo plan and the reality of moving petroleum cargoes across the world's oceans.

As a Master Mariner, he spent years commanding large crude and product tankers, transporting substantial volumes of energy cargoes through complex maritime routes and terminal environments. He learned the petroleum chain not from theory, but from operational reality: cargo planning, stowage and stability, bunkering operations, pump rates, terminal procedures, vetting, Q&Q protocols, sampling, voyage performance and risk management.

This background enables him to bridge two disciplines that are often disconnected: maritime operational expertise and structured petroleum brokerage governance — combining seagoing command-level experience with trading discipline, institutional communication standards and compliance-oriented execution.

Mr. Ajibola Aderemi
Commercial & Operations Associate · Business Development · London, UK

Mr. Ajibola Aderemi brings a rigorous and operationally grounded perspective to NaviTrade Energy's commercial and documentation function. With a background anchored in physical trade operations at BP Trading & Shipping — one of the world's most demanding energy trading environments — he brings a depth of documentary and compliance experience that is directly applicable to NaviTrade's structured brokerage model.

At BP, he served as Document Administration Coordinator (Subject Matter Expert) for West African crude and refined product operations, where he led a remediation project achieving a 92% clearance rate on a 4,700-document backlog. He designed and deployed an EMEA-wide custom approval workflow that delivered a 67% reduction in processing time, directly preventing costly documentary demurrage — in some cases up to £50,000 per day — through proactive discrepancy identification and strict terminal compliance enforcement.

His hands-on expertise spans Bills of Lading, Commercial Invoices, ICPOs, Letters of Credit and Letters of Indemnity, with deep working knowledge of Incoterms 2020, FOB, TTT, and TTV transaction structures. He has coordinated physical documentation flows across multiple concurrent international trades, interfacing directly with operators, shippers, inspection companies, trade finance banks and in-country contacts across West African markets.

At NaviTrade Energy, Mr. Aderemi supports the commercial and operations desk as a Commercial & Operations Associate, conducting preliminary KYC/KYB checks, verifying trade documentation, advising on Incoterms application, and managing end-to-end deal documentation flow with audit-ready precision. His rare combination of physical trading documentation expertise, regulatory compliance discipline, and operational systems proficiency (SAP, OWB, Power BI, Advanced Excel) positions him as a strong operational asset within NaviTrade's lean, high-standards team.
